Как установить elasticsearch на windows

Зачем и как устанавливать Elasticsearch?

Зачем и как устанавливать Elasticsearch?

Elasticsearch – это распределенная поисковая и аналитическая система, которая централизованно хранит ваши данные, чтобы вы могли искать, индексировать и анализировать данные любых форм и размеров.

Elasticsearch поможет ускорить поиск, который вы контролируете, и увидите, какие данные, страницы или продукты ищут чаще всего. Это поможет вам определить, на чем следует сосредоточиться и оптимизировать.

Независимо от того, ищете ли вы действие с определенного IP-адреса, анализируете всплеск транзакционных запросов или ищете пиццу в радиусе двух миль, данные могут решить эти проблемы. Elasticsearch позволяет легко хранить, искать и анализировать данные в любом масштабе.

Попробуйте бесплатно наше приложение для управления серверами и доменами. Вы почувствуете себя опытным администратором.

Для чего можно использовать Elasticsearch?

  • Мониторинг журналов — из системы, MySQL в Apache
  • Мониторинг инфраструктуры — серверы, Docker, Kubernetes, приложения
  • APM — отслеживайте производительность вашего приложения
  • Время безотказной работы — мониторинг доступности ваших систем в режиме реального времени
  • Поиск по сайту . Простое создание расширенного поиска на вашем сайте
  • Поиск приложений . Поиск по документам, географическим регионам, данным и даже непосредственно в приложении
  • Карты – Поиск местоположений в данных в реальном времени
  • SIEM — интерактивный поиск и автоматическое обнаружение угроз безопасности
  • Endpoint Security — Предотвращение и обнаружение угроз безопасности

Elasticsearch работает очень быстро

Когда вы получаете ответы мгновенно, ваше отношение к данным меняется. Вы можете позволить себе повторить и охватить больше.математика означает процесс многократного использования функции с целью приближения, достижения цели или результата. Каждое повторение процесса также называется итерацией, и результаты одной итерации используются в качестве входных данных для следующей итерации.

Читайте также:  Windows xp sp3 zver как установить с флешки

Они внедрили инвертированные индексы с конечными преобразователями состояний для полнотекстовых запросов, деревья KDB для хранения числовых и географических данных и внедрили хранилища столбцов для простого и быстрого анализа данных.

Индексирование — это процесс, при котором документы хранятся в инвертированном индексе. Благодаря этому важные термины располагаются в базовой форме в алфавитном порядке. Это поможет ускорить поиск, потому что искать нужно не весь документ, а только действительно важные вещи. Вы можете определить их, отсортировать в соответствии с вашими потребностями и т. д.

В ИТ дерево KDB называется структурой данных для разделения пространства поиска. Он направлен на обеспечение эффективности поиска при одновременном предоставлении блочного хранилища для оптимизации доступа к внешней памяти. Это полезно для таких задач, как поиск диапазона и многомерные запросы к базе данных.

Чтобы получить более подробное описание на чешском языке, мы рекомендуем серию статей об Elasticsearch от Luďek Veselý.

Сколько стоит Elasticsearch?

У Elasticsearch открытый исходный код, поэтому он бесплатный. Вы можете разработать свое приложение с его помощью, ничего не платя. Весь код находится в общедоступном репозитории.

Конечно, разработка стоит денег, поэтому она предлагает корпоративные решения, которые используются, например, Netflix, Uber, Slack или даже Microsoft. У них есть новые функции в виде машинного обучения, межкластерной репликации, моментальных снимков и т. д.

Freelo — инструмент управления задачами и проектами

Присоединяйтесь, приглашайте свою команду и клиентов, разделяйте работу и наблюдайте за выполнением задач.

Вы также можете использовать Elasticsearchв их облаке, где цена начинается от 16 долларов США в месяц, а затем вам просто нужно подключить Elastic к своему приложению. Это зависит от того, что вам нужно, но для большинства веб-сайтов и приложений подойдет бесплатная версия, которую мы вам сейчас покажем.

Читайте также:  Как использовать windows 7 на amd ryzen

Как установить Elasticsearch на Debian?

Для этого мы будем использовать наши виртуальные серверы с VPS Center, которые работают в системе Debian, и вы в любом случае можете установить его на Ubuntu.

Сначала мы загружаем пакет JDK (Java Development Kit)

aptitude install default-jdk

Загрузите ключ GPG и вставьте репозиторий ES.

wget -qO — https://artifacts.elastic.co/GPG-KEY-elasticsearchвиртуальная машина)

  • /etc/elasticsearch/log4j2.properties — для настройки ведения журнала ES
  • Elasticsearch.yml будет наиболее полезен там, где вы можете изменить порт, пути к данным и журналам, установить сеть и шлюз и, конечно же, при необходимости изменить имя кластера.

    Как установить конкретную версию Elasticsearch?

    Мы покажем вам, как установить конкретную версию Elasticsearch, например 7.4.0.

    Самый простой способ — скачать нужную версию пакета.

    Нам нужен Elasticsearch 7.4.0, поэтому мы запустили команду по SSH:

    Мы проверим, совпадают ли ключи SHA

    Затем мы устанавливаем пакет, запускаем ES и проверяем, запускается ли он.

    Мы все еще можем проверить версию и работу ES с помощью команды

    Последний прием, который может пригодиться, — это приостановка автоматических обновлений. Мы уже несколько раз решали, что он не работает после обновления. Вы можете приостановить обновления с помощью следующих команд:

    aptitude Hold elasticsearch

    apt-mark hold elasticsearch

    Пособота — Лекция про Elasticsearch

    Конечно, установка — это только начало. Для лучшего представления о том, как можно использовать и настраивать ЭП, рекомендуем запись из классической доковидной Пособоты.

    Кибана + Elasticsearch

    Для более удобной работы с Elastic рекомендуется установить еще одно приложение — Kibana. Это значительно облегчит работу. Kibana — это графический интерфейс, который может подключаться и отображать данные более удобным способом. Он может лучше искать сохраненные данные, создавать визуализации графиков и таблиц, а также создавать сложные информационные панели.

    Благодаря Кибане вы получаете

    • Очистить анализ журнала
    • Мониторинг инфраструктуры
    • APM — мониторинг производительности приложений
    • Обзор действий по обеспечению безопасности
    • Бизнесаналитика

    Этого достаточно для одного приложения мониторинга. В следующей статье вы узнаете, как правильно установить его на наши сервера с помощью VPS Center.

    Поделиться с друзьями
    ОС советы